Abstract

This article studies the importance of the Siem Reap River. Towards the capital city By collecting data about the Siem Reap River Despite those already collected And from the author traveling to study in Siem Reap Cambodia After that it was an analysis of those works. And from having gathered data from other sources as supplementary data for analysis Which the study found that The smooth river is very important to the capital city. Especially during the reign of King Yasothorn Man 1 to the reign of King Jayavarman VII, also known as The era of the Kingdom of Angkor was a time when the Siem Reap river was important in all areas. The Siem Reap River is a river that is important to the way of life of the Thung people. Since ancient times In this article, the author tries to explain the details and various important issues of the Siem Reap River to the capital city. And the relationship of the Siem Reap River with other water sources that are important to the building and growth of the capital city Which can explain important issues such as The importance of the Siem Reap River to politics and government Of the capital city The importance of the Yom Smooth River to the capital city economy The importance of the Siem Reap river to the society and way of life of the people of Phra Nakhon However, studying the importance of the Siem Reap River The city of Phra Nakhon is only a part of the city irrigation because there is still the Tonle Sap or Khmer Lake and the Mekong River, which is the source of the Khmer civilization centered on the capital city. Therefore, the study of the importance of the Siem Reap smooth river The author therefore does not study only the area of ​​the Siem Reap River. But also to study the Tonle Sap or Khmer Lake and the various evidence found, which this article will present various issues related to the Siem Reap River, Khmer Lake and Mekong River that are important to the Angkor.
